The Silent Witness: Inside the World of a Forensic Toxicologist
Forensic toxicologists undertake a critical role in the criminal system, often working in the scenes to determine the truth surrounding unexplained deaths and injuries. Their profession involves the meticulous examination of bodily matter, such as blood and urine, to identify the presence of drugs, alcohol, and other toxic compounds. They utilize sophisticated instruments and analytical techniques to assess these substances, then analyze their findings to support investigations. It’s a demanding field requiring a deep understanding of chemistry and biology, as each case presents a distinct puzzle to resolve. The insights they provide can be the crucial piece of evidence in bringing justice to those affected and ensuring that responsibility is placed where it belongs.

A Forensic Analysis Pipeline: Moving Criminal Location to a Courtroom
The forensic science pipeline is a complex process, shifting physical evidence collected at a illegal scene into acceptable information for the legal system. It begins with preliminary response, where investigators secure the area and document potential indicators . Next, specialists – often crime lab scientists – carefully retrieve and package the items. Back in the lab , samples undergo rigorous examination utilizing various methods , including DNA profiling , latent recognition, and chemical material assessment. Findings are then meticulously assessed and summarized into a complete report, which can be shown as testimony in the courtroom, potentially influencing a jury's verdict . Finally , the pipeline strives to ensure that scientific observations are accurately presented to support the pursuit of justice.
- Documentation of the scene .
- Careful retrieval of materials.
- Rigorous forensic analysis.
- Precise documenting of data.
